Near-term mix: Aerospace and aftermarket remain the key stabilisers

Near-term growth visibility appears strongest in Flex-Tek Aerospace, supported by high order coverage, long-term contracts, pricing

catch-up and volume commitments. Across the group, aftermarket remains the most accretive profit pool, underpinned by strong

pricing power and customer need for uptime/reliability. In John Crane, regional strength is visible in pockets such as Latin America, West

Africa/Nigeria and Brazil offshore, with Mexico reopening and some incremental activity into Venezuela also providing positive

dynamics.
